This painting shows a tall, pale figure with a serious face. The body is made of cut-out text—words like "crime," "fight," and "trouble" pasted over the torso. The background is messy, with scribbled notes, doodles, and smudges of paint. The words on the body read like a list of struggles, mixed with handwritten phrases about fighting.
